Output c31e705caf99ab253e430265cc472d721fea8a8881896a06de00bb4ab0b697db:0

value
104385159660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5740b9248064b9dbe42f2bc3227434b0b8b05d5e OP_EQUALVERIFY OP_CHECKSIG
address
DD6Srzgi3b3rXujfm786Nz8av8ZECpGA32
transaction
c31e705caf99ab253e430265cc472d721fea8a8881896a06de00bb4ab0b697db